A RESOLUTION REVISING GATE EEES AND HOURS OF OPERATION AT THE NEAL ROAD SANITARY LANDFILL IN BUTTE COUNTY WHEREAS, Neal Road Landfill Company (Contractor) and County of Butte entered into an agreement for operation and maintenance of Neal Road Sanitary Landfill on May 15, 1978; and WHEREAS, Section 12 of the contract provides for a change in cost of doing business whereby the compensation to the contractor shall be increased or decreased in a percentage amount equal to two-thirds (2/3) of the net per- centage change in the consumer price index by either raising gate fees or by other compensation; and WHEREAS, such increased cost of doing business necessitate a 3.52 percent increase in existing gate fees to provide the necessary revenue; and WHEREAS, new legislation including but not limited to Assembly Bill 939 (Sher, et al, Chapter 1095 of the Statutes of 1989) requires extensive changes in solid waste management in the State of California; and WHEREAS, complying with new legislation and requirements will sig- nificantly increase the cost of solid waste management; and WHEREAS, such increased cost of solid waste management necessitate a 6.48 percent increase in existing gate fees to provide the necessary revenue; and WHEREAS, having considered this matter at a public meeting of this Board on June 5, 1990, and having considered oral and written presentations submitted at said meeting, and the data indicating the estimated costs required for solid waste management in accordance with state law having been made avail- able to the public prior to said meetings as required by law, and this Board having found that the proposed gate fees do not exceed such estimated costs; and WHEREAS, Contractor has requested a change in the hours of operation of the landfill to better serve the needs of the solid waste collectors in the county. NOW, 'T'HE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ED by the Butte County Board of Supervisors as follows: 1. That in order to provide a ten percent overall increase in exist- ing gate fees for Contractor's increased cost of doing business and for increased cost of solid waste management, that the gate fees for the operation and maintenance of the Neal Road Sanitary Landfill are established as set forth in Exhibit "A" attached hereto. 2. That the hours of operation be revised to be as follows: I-lours of operation are from 6:30 A.M. to 5:00 P.M., seven days per week, throughout the year, with the exception of the five major holidays of Christmas, New Years, Easter, Fourth of July and Thanksgiving, during which the site is closed. Admittance is not permitted in the final 15 minutes of operation. 3. That this resolution shall be effective on July 1, 1990.
